Alien  1.3.0
Developer documentation
Loading...
Searching...
No Matches
Alien::UniverseDataBase::Key< T > Struct Template Reference

Key object. More...

Inheritance diagram for Alien::UniverseDataBase::Key< T >:
Collaboration diagram for Alien::UniverseDataBase::Key< T >:

Public Member Functions

virtual ~Key ()
 Free resources.
 Key (T &&t)
 Constructor \para[in] t The key.
Public Member Functions inherited from Alien::UniverseDataBase::IKey
virtual ~IKey ()
 Free resources.

Public Attributes

value
 The key.

Additional Inherited Members

Protected Member Functions inherited from Alien::UniverseDataBase::IKey
 IKey ()
 Constructor.

Detailed Description

template<typename T>
struct Alien::UniverseDataBase::Key< T >

Key object.

Template Parameters
TThe type of the key

Definition at line 99 of file UniverseDataBase.h.

Constructor & Destructor Documentation

◆ ~Key()

template<typename T>
virtual Alien::UniverseDataBase::Key< T >::~Key ( )
inlinevirtual

Free resources.

Definition at line 102 of file UniverseDataBase.h.

◆ Key()

template<typename T>
Alien::UniverseDataBase::Key< T >::Key ( T && t)
inline

Constructor \para[in] t The key.

Definition at line 108 of file UniverseDataBase.h.

References value.

Member Data Documentation

◆ value

template<typename T>
T Alien::UniverseDataBase::Key< T >::value

The key.

Definition at line 113 of file UniverseDataBase.h.

Referenced by Key().


The documentation for this struct was generated from the following file: